How to fill out the NEC Standard Electrical Load Calculation for Dwellings online

Filling out the NEC Standard Electrical Load Calculation for Dwellings is an essential task for ensuring compliance with electrical standards in residential settings. This guide provides clear, step-by-step instructions to assist users in completing the form accurately and efficiently online.

Follow the steps to complete the NEC Standard Electrical Load Calculation for Dwellings.

  1. Click ‘Get Form’ button to obtain the form and open it in the editor.
  2. Begin by entering the owner's name and the location of the dwelling in the designated fields. This information is crucial for documentation purposes.
  3. Next, indicate the total floor area of the dwelling in square feet. Refer to NEC 220.12 for guidance on calculating this value.
  4. Under the 'General Lighting' section, calculate the general lighting load. This involves multiplying the total square footage by 3 VA per square foot as indicated in Table 220.12.
  5. Record the number of small appliance circuits and multiply it by 1500 VA per circuit, ensuring a minimum of two circuits as specified in NEC 220.52(A).
  6. For the laundry circuit, note the quantity and again multiply by 1500 VA per circuit as detailed in NEC 220.52(B).
  7. Add the amounts from steps 4, 5, and 6 to determine the total general lighting load.
  8. Calculate the first 3000 VA at 100% and then derive the net general lighting load by applying the 35% factor on any excess above 3000 VA.
  9. In the appliances section, provide the necessary details for up to 3 appliances or apply the 75% rule for 4 or more appliances as outlined in NEC 220.53.
  10. Document the volt-amperes (VA) for all included appliances, including any adjustments as necessary, making sure to follow the nameplate ratings and adjusted ratings.
  11. Calculate the total volt-amperes by summing the values recorded in the previous steps. Then, divide this total by 240-volts to get the amperes.
  12. Indicate the conductor size and service rating, specifying whether it is copper or aluminum.
  13. Finally, review all entries for accuracy and make any necessary adjustments before saving, downloading, or printing the completed form.

To calculate specific electric loading, focus on particular circuits or areas within your home. Measure the total wattage and note the number of connected devices. By applying the NEC Standard Electrical Load Calculation for Dwellings, you can ensure that the specific load does not exceed the circuit's capacity.

To perform a load calculation on a residential home, begin by listing all electrical appliances, lighting fixtures, and outlets. Use the NEC Standard Electrical Load Calculation for Dwellings to determine the total load, ensuring to include demand factors and any special requirements for larger appliances. This process gives you a clear picture of your electrical needs.

The formula for calculating electrical load is generally expressed as Total Load (in watts) = Voltage x Current. However, for residential use, it is essential to apply the NEC Standard Electrical Load Calculation for Dwellings, which incorporates various factors, such as the number of outlets, fixed appliances, and demand adjustments.

To conduct an electrical load study, first identify all electrical appliances and devices in the dwelling. Next, calculate the wattage for each device and sum these values to determine the total load. Following the NEC Standard Electrical Load Calculation for Dwellings ensures you account for demand factors and potential growth in electrical use.

To calculate the electrical load for a house, list all the circuits and devices you plan to use, noting their wattage. Sum the total wattage and divide by the voltage to obtain the total amperage. This process, guided by the NEC Standard Electrical Load Calculation for Dwellings, helps ensure your home’s electrical system can handle its load safely and effectively.

According to NEC guidelines, dwelling unit outlets should be spaced no more than 12 feet apart along any wall. This spacing ensures accessibility to outlets throughout the house. Using the NEC Standard Electrical Load Calculation for Dwellings can assist in planning the layout of your electrical system effectively, providing ample access while staying compliant.

The NEC code for dwelling units consists of several articles that deal with safety and functionality concerning electrical systems. Mainly, Article 210 focuses on branch circuits and the effective distribution of electrical load. Understanding these regulations is key for implementing the NEC Standard Electrical Load Calculation for Dwellings in residential settings.

NEC code 210.12 D addresses the installation of tamper-resistant receptacles in dwelling units. This requirement is crucial for safety, especially in homes where children are present. It’s an important aspect to consider when applying the NEC Standard Electrical Load Calculation for Dwellings to improve safety and compliance in your home.

NEC code 210.52 A 1 outlines the requirements for receptacle outlet placement in dwelling units. It ensures that every wall space has at least one outlet, enhancing convenience and safety. By following this standard, you align your installation with the NEC Standard Electrical Load Calculation for Dwellings, ensuring adequate access for electrical devices.

To calculate the load for a dwelling unit, consider all fixed and variable electrical appliances. Use the NEC Standard Electrical Load Calculation for Dwellings to guide your assessment and ensure compliance with safety standards. This detailed calculation provides a solid foundation for your home’s electrical design.

NEC Article 220 offers two distinct paths for how to complete load calculations: the Standard Method (Part III) and the Optional Method (Part IV). The Standard Method outlined in NFPA 70 is used for determining dwelling unit service load. The Standard Method outlined in NFPA 70 is used for determining dwelling unit service load. Worksheet 4 uses the "standard" method of calculation (NEC 220.1 through 220.61) and can be used for two-family dwelling calculations.
